首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Where条件不适用于group by

是指在SQL语句中,无法在group by子句中使用where条件来过滤数据。group by子句用于将结果集按照指定的列进行分组,而where条件用于过滤满足特定条件的行。

在SQL语句中,通常的执行顺序是先执行where条件过滤,然后再执行group by分组。因此,where条件无法直接应用于group by子句,因为where条件在group by之前执行,而group by之后的结果集已经被分组。

如果需要在group by子句中使用条件过滤,可以使用having子句来代替。having子句在group by之后执行,可以对分组后的结果集进行条件过滤。

以下是一个示例:

代码语言:txt
复制
SELECT column1, column2
FROM table
WHERE condition
GROUP BY column1
HAVING condition;

在上述示例中,where条件用于过滤行,group by子句用于按照column1列进行分组,having子句用于对分组后的结果集进行条件过滤。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 TencentDB:https://cloud.tencent.com/product/cdb
  • 腾讯云云服务器 CVM:https://cloud.tencent.com/product/cvm
  • 腾讯云人工智能 AI:https://cloud.tencent.com/product/ai
  • 腾讯云物联网 IoT Hub:https://cloud.tencent.com/product/iothub
  • 腾讯云移动开发 MSDK:https://cloud.tencent.com/product/msdk
  • 腾讯云存储 COS:https://cloud.tencent.com/product/cos
  • 腾讯云区块链 TBaaS:https://cloud.tencent.com/product/tbaas
  • 腾讯云元宇宙 Tencent XR:https://cloud.tencent.com/product/xr
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券